Night Fury Posted December 8, 2009 Report Posted December 8, 2009 I'm officially a total third gen GP nerd. So.... I need some help. If any of you see one of these cars, please (at least) get the Vin # for me! Me love you long time! If you want to go above and beyond(which I would greatly appreciate), I could also use the following info: -Color of brake calipers(Black/silver or red) -Color of engine cover(Regular gray or all red) -Build date(On drivers door jamb) -What the console below the shifter says("TAPshift" or "TACshift") -Color of car -Anything else you find usable. Here are some identification pics: Different badges than regular third gen GPs: This badge will be on the trunk: These will be on the front doors, regular third gen GPs didn't get anything on the doors: Silver/black calipers: (Regular Comp G's have red calipers) Thanks anyone for any help!!!
